At birth, the average baby's brain is about a quarter the size of an average adult brain. It doubles its size during the child's first year. By age 5, 90% of a child's brain is developed! Research has shown how critical these first 5 years are. By providing regular opportunities for learning, good nutrition & a loving, nurturing environment, we can set our children up for success!
Great Start Collaborative & Parent Coalition: The purpose of the Great Start Collaborative of Huron County is to ensure families have the resources they need so their young children are healthy, safe, happy, and prepared to succeed in school. They seek input from parents about what their needs are so they can make changes to the services they provide and create new programs to better meet families' needs.
